WebTo use this online calculator for Nernst Distribution Law Coefficient, enter Concentration of Solute in Solvent 1 (C1) & Concentration of solute in solvent 2 (C2) and hit the calculate … WebThe Nernst–Planck equation is a conservation of mass equation used to describe the motion of a charged chemical species in a fluid medium. It extends Fick's law of diffusion for the case where the diffusing particles are also moved with respect to the fluid by electrostatic forces. [1] [2] It is named after Walther Nernst and Max Planck .

WebJul 2, 2024 · Nernst distribution law. According to distribution law if x 1 is a concentration of solute in Phase 1 andx 2 to the concentration of salute in phase 2 the distribution Coefficient is given by x 1 /x 2. This law gives the best results when employed under the following conditions. At constant temperature Used solutions are dilute WebFeb 16, 2024 · 2. APPLICATIONS OF NERNST DISTRIBUTION LAW : • Determination of degree of association • Determination of degree of dissociation • Solvent Extraction 19-September -20. 3. WebThe Nernst equation describes the variation in the potential of a redox system (such as a galvanic cell) from its standard state value. It is dependent on the number of electrons transferred during the redox reaction, n, the temperature measured in kelvin, T, and the reaction mixture composition given as Q.
